Thumbs up Carb can't compare?????

not to start a flaming war,but saying a carb can't compare to fuel injection is a pretty strong statement. I do not know how much racing you keep up with but NMRA has a class called Hot Street where the cars run NA big inch high compression Windsor based engines and inline heads,Ken Compton started the year off with DFI Accel injection and was running 9.50's and the occassional 9.40 making 790hp,since he has switched to a HP type carburetor,and Super Victor intake and has been running 9.30's since.

I am a fuelie guy through and through but saying a carb can't compare to fuel injection in a NA application that is a stretch,plus you cannot compare cost either.
